Tiburón Island (in Spanish: Isla del Tiburón or Isla Tiburón) is both the largest island in the Gulf of California and the largest island in Mexico, with an area of 464 square miles (1201 square kilometers). It was made a nature reserve in 1963 by President López Mateos. Tiburón is Spanish for "shark".

Tiburón Island is part of the state of Sonora, as well as the municipality of Hermosillo, and is located at approximately the same latitude as the city of Hermosillo. It is located along the eastern shore of the Gulf of California, opposite Isla Ángel de la Guarda. It is part of the chain of islands known as the Midriff Islands or Islas Grandes.

The island is presently uninhabited (except for a military installation on the eastern side of the island) and is administered as an ecological preserve by the Seri tribal government, in conjunction with the federal government.

The island can be reached from Punta Chueca, which is the nearest community, inhabited by members of the Seri tribe, and from Bahía de Kino, a (non-Indian) community 34 km to the south. The distance from Punta Chueca to Punta Tormenta, the nearest point on the island is 3 km. The channel between the mainland and the island is called Canal del Infiernillo (Hell's Channel), due to the strong tidal flow and shoal water that occur there which can make for challenging maritime navigation. The island has a prominent mountain system of volcanic origin. Source: Wikipedia.org
